Performance CV

In this format emphasis is placed on employment history, including job titles, companies, responsibilities and achievements in a professional capacity.

This CV is most useful for those who:

  • Are seeking employment within the same field as previous experience
  • Want to highlight their professional achievements such as promotions
  • Want the names of their employers and their duties to be clearly evidenced

It is not suitable if:

  • You want a change in career
  • You have frequently changed employer or not stayed in a job for a great period of time
  • You have been out of work for periods of time for any reason
  • Your achievements are not in line with the career you wish to pursue now

What to include:

  • 3 to 6 functional headings.
    Select headings that are appropriate to the new position you are applying for
    You should have 2 to 5 bullet points under each heading evidencing your experience and skills
  • Achievements
  • Employment history
  • Professional Qualifications and Training
  • Education and Qualifications
  • Personal Details
  • Hobbies and Interests
